Angelina Jolie to star in 'Maleficent' sequel and also take up directorial gigs

About five months following her acrimonious split from husband Brad Pitt, Angelina Jolie now seems eager to put her entire life in order again by giving some importance to her reeling acting career. According to the Hollywood Reporter who recently ran an exclusive story on the star, she is set to reprise her role as the titular character in a sequel to Disney's 'Maleficent'. Disney itself also did announce this week that they are working on 'Maleficent 2'. If everything goes as scheduled, the filming for the upcoming film could start in May this year.

Back to Angelina Jolie, the A-lister has been absent from the screens and the public eye for quite a while. She has been keeping away from the limelight ever since she much publicized divorce announcement in September last year. It was only until a week ago that she came out again in the company of all her children to promote a film she had directed in Cambodia. This is a Netflix-sponsored movie titled 'First They Killed My Father'. It's based on a memoir about a deadly regime in the Asian country.

Jolie's acting career has suffered an apparent dry spell. Her last onscreen role was in 2014 where she co-starred with her ex-husband in 'By The Sea', a film that bombed. Her last acting role on its part was in 2015 when she lent her voice to the film 'Kung Fu Panda' 3. Directorial roles

It's not only her acting career that is set to experience a major comeback, Angelina Jolie is also set to retake directorial and production roles. It's reported that the mother of six is considering taking up directorial roles in a number of high-profile films. These include among others an adaptation of Alessandro Barrico's 2004 war-themed novel titled 'Without Blood'.

Angelina on the breakup of her marriage

The 'Mr & Mrs. Smith' actress recently opened up about her failed marriage after remaining mom on it ever since news about it became public. Speaking exclusively to the BBC, she said it was a difficult experience but that above all, they still remain a family and hope to emerge stronger from everything.

Jolie and her 'Allied' star ex-husband have decided to proceed with the rest of their divorce case privately. This, they believe will help safeguard the wellbeing of their children. It's not very clear what exactly caused the celebrity pair's split. Brad was initially being accused of child abuse and this was believed to have contributed to his and Angelina's split. He has however since been cleared of the allegations by the Federal Bureau of Investigation.
